Bill would boost the number of residency slots in radiology and other specialties

The Resident Physician Shortage Reduction Act would add another 14,000 Medicare-supported medical residency positions over a seven-year period.

CMS proposes 2.8% rate increase for inpatient payments in 2024

CMS is also proposing that rural emergency hospitals be designated graduate medical education training sites, enabling more medical students to train in those areas.
